Street market cocaine is frequently altered or diluted with virtually any tasteless odourless white powder to increase its weight; the substances most commonly used in this process are baking soda; sugars, such as lactose, dextrose, and mannitol; and local anaesthetics, such as lidocaine or benzocaine, which mimic or add to cocaine's numbing effect on mucous membranes. Both drugs may be used as maintenance medications (taken for an indefinite period of time), or used as detoxification aids.[8] All available studies collected in the 2005 Australian National Evaluation of Pharmacotherapies for Opioid Dependence suggest that maintenance treatment is preferable,[8] with very high rates (79–100%)[8] of relapse within three months of detoxification from LAAM, buprenorphine, and methadone.[8][9] Ibogaine is a hallucinogenic drug promoted by certain fringe groups to interrupt both physical dependence and psychological craving to a broad range or drugs including narcotics, stimulants, alcohol and nicotine. Researchers studying the cocktailing effects of mixing cocaine with alcohol discovered that the human liver combines cocaine with grain alcohol to produce a new substance called "cocaethylene" which intensifies the effects of both the cocaine and the alcohol while drastically increasing the risk of fatality. The AA 12-step approach involves psychosocial techniques used in changing behavior (eg, rewards, social support networks, role models). Each new person is assigned an AA sponsor (a person recovering from alcoholism who supervises and supports the recovery of the new member).
